The footpath that leads up to the Lansdowne Monument and Cherhill White Horse affords a spectacular view over the surrounding Wiltshire countryside. Both landmarks are popular visitor attractions and are situated on a steep slope on the edge of the Cherhill Downs, the White Horse and Obelisk are clearly visible from the A4 Calne to Marlborough road.
